offers a useful approach to understanding individuals in organizations. This approach emphasizes understanding the person and the situations in order to understand human behavior. III. PERSONALITY. Personality . is an individual difference that lends consistency to a person’s behavior. Both heredity and environmental forces shape personality.

There are several schools of thought that explain different parts of the human behavior puzzle or that explain the same part in different ways. We will briefly consider four of the major approaches to understanding behavior. These approaches are classified as (a) behavioral, (b) biophysical, (c) ecological, and (d) psychodynamic models.
